News Video: Off Duty Patrol Officer Latavius McIntosh Arrested For Aggravated Assault

14345866_G

DAWSON, GA – A Dawson Police officer was arrested after an investigation by the Georgia Bureau of Investigation.

According to the GBI, the Dawson Police Department requested assistance after a report that Latavius McIntosh, 27, pointed a gun at another person during an altercation.

Officials said the incident happened on July 5 at a residence in the 400 block of Oak Street, and McIntosh was not on duty at the time.

A criminal arrest warrant was issued for aggravated assault, and McIntosh was arrested and booked into the Terrell County Jail on the same day.
